Simon Whitmarsh-Knight, EMEA Marketing Director, Textiles Business Unit. © Hyosung CorporationHyosung Corporation, a specialist in recycling nylon and polyester and a leading spandex producer, has appointed Simon Whitmarsh-Knight as an EMEA Marketing Director of its growing Textiles Business Unit.

According to the company, Mr Whitmarsh-Knight brings over 25 years of experience in B2B sales and marketing roles within the textiles, apparel and sporting goods industries, including waterproof, breathable membranes, Hackett menswear, sealskinz waterproof accessories, Mitre sports and Invista.

At Hyosung, Simon will be responsible for expanding the marketing team and for the promotion of specialty Hyosung fibres and fabrics, including creora spandex and Mipan nylon, to target retail and brand accounts. In his role, Mr Whitmarsh-Knight will manage joint development and promotional programmes with key industry partners, as well as working on vital industry topics, such as sustainable innovations.

“It’s a great time to join this industry leader and I look forward to growing the team and taking our innovative fibre technologies to brands and retailers across Europe,” said Mr Whitmarsh-Knight.

Hyosung Corporation is one of Korea’s leading multinational conglomerates, with annual worldwide sales of more than US$ 8.7 billion. Hyosung maintains a network of more than 73 subsidiaries and international branch offices around the globe.

The company operates in seven performance groups, which include: textiles, industrial materials, chemicals, power and industrial systems, construction, trading and information and communication.
